    Can ChatGPT create a presentation?

    So, can you just ask ChatGPT to make a presentation for you? The short answer is yes—and no. While ChatGPT is a powerhouse for generating text, outlines, and ideas, it can’t create a visual slideshow on its own. It’s a language model, which means it works with words, not with slide layouts, color palettes, or image placement. It can give you a fantastic script or a detailed outline for each slide, but you’re still left with the task of manually building the presentation deck.

    Start with ChatGPT and then move into Prezi AI

    If you want the content to be sharper—especially for higher-stakes decks—use ChatGPT first to craft the narrative and slide plan, then “hand it off” to Prezi AI for design and structure.

    This use case works when you want to narrow down the storyline and positioning, you have a complex topic, or you want to control the arc before design begins.

    Here’s how to create a presentation using ChatGPT and Prezi AI:

    1. Generate a strong slide-by-slide outline in ChatGPT.
      Ask for:
      • Slide titles
      • Key bullets (3–5 max per slide)
      • Speaker notes (30–60 seconds per slide)
      • Suggested visuals per slide (charts, icons, metaphors)
    2. Edit and fact-check.
      • Verify stats, dates, claims, names.
      • Replace vague claims with specific evidence.
      • Match the tone to your audience and brand voice.
    3. Paste the refined outline into Prezi AI.
      • Prezi AI turns your text structure into a designed, visual narrative.
    4. Make final customizations in Prezi AI

    Here’s an example for what you could drop directly into ChatGPT:
    “Write a 10-slide presentation outline on [TOPIC] for [AUDIENCE]. Goal: [WHAT THEY SHOULD DO/DECIDE]. Tone: [TONE]. Include: hook, agenda, problem, insight, 3 key points, proof/examples, objections & responses, summary, call to action, Q&A. For each slide provide: title, 3–5 bullets, 45 seconds of speaker notes, and 1–2 visual suggestions.”

    Tips for prompt creation

    The quality of your AI-generated presentation starts with the quality of your instructions. Vague prompts lead to generic results. Instead of asking for “a presentation on marketing,” be specific. Try something like, “Generate a 5-slide outline for a presentation on our Q3 social media strategy for an internal marketing team. Include a title, an agenda, a review of Q2 KPIs, a slide on the new strategy, and a Q&A slide.” This level of detail helps the AI understand your audience, goals, and the exact content you need to build.

    Select your visuals

    While ChatGPT is a language model, it can be your creative partner for visuals. It can’t create images for you, but it can give you great ideas. Describe a slide’s content and ask, “What are three visual concepts for this slide?” It might suggest a bar chart to show growth, an icon to represent a key idea, or a specific type of stock photo to evoke an emotion.     Fact-check your content

    This is a non-negotiable step. AI models are trained on vast datasets, but they don’t “know” things in the way a human does. They can make mistakes, misinterpret data, or even generate information that sounds plausible but is completely incorrect. Because of these known limitations, you must act as the final editor and fact-checker. Always verify statistics, dates, names, and critical facts with trusted sources before you present. Your credibility is on the line, and a quick check can save you from sharing inaccurate information with your audience.
